Power of a power, step by step
Raise a power to another power and the exponents multiply: (2³)⁴ is 2¹².

- (12⁶)⁵ means 5 copies of 12⁶, all multiplied together.
- Each copy is 6 12s, and there are 5 copies — so that is 6 × 5 = 30 of them.
- 30 12s multiplied together is 12³⁰. So n = 30. The shortcut: a power raised to a power MULTIPLIES the exponents.
